Angelina College Police Academy: Training Tomorrow's Peace Officers Today

Angelina College Police Academy delivers rigorous training for entry-level law enforcement in Lufkin and surrounding communities. The program blends classroom instruction with hands-on drills to prepare recruits for real-world patrol and response scenarios.

Designed with input from local agencies, the academy emphasizes ethics, de-escalation, and technical skills. Graduates frequently enter regional departments ready to serve with confidence and professionalism.

Physical Conditioning Requirements

Physical readiness is central to success in the Angelina College Police Academy. Recruits follow a structured conditioning plan that builds endurance, strength, and agility over the training period.

The academy sets clear benchmarks for running, calisthenics, and obstacle navigation. Instructors monitor progress and provide modifications to help each recruit reach the required fitness level safely.

Strength and Agility Drills

Strength sessions focus on functional movements such as pulling, pushing, and core stability. Agility drills improve footwork, coordination, and rapid direction changes needed in patrol duties.

Timed Runs and Recovery Techniques

Recruits complete progressive run intervals to build aerobic capacity. Emphasis on warm-up, cool-down, and recovery supports long-term performance and injury prevention.

Classroom modules cover criminal law, search and seizure, traffic codes, and report writing grounded in Texas statutes. Angelina College partners with local agencies to ensure the curriculum reflects current legal standards and enforcement practices.

Interactive lectures, case studies, and written exams help recruits internalize key concepts. Instructors emphasize ethical decision-making, proportionate use-of-force, and communication skills that de-escalate potential conflicts.

Field Training and Scenario Simulations

Field training connects theory to practice through controlled scenarios and community interactions. Recruits perform traffic stops, building searches, and crisis intervention drills under close supervision.

Role-playing exercises test judgment and communication abilities. Feedback from instructors and peers helps refine tactics, documentation, and professionalism in dynamic environments.

FAQ

Reader questions

What are the minimum physical requirements to enroll in the Angelina College Police Academy?

Applicants must meet timed run, push-up, and sit-up standards, pass a medical exam, and complete a background investigation before academy entry.

How long is the training program and what topics are covered in class?

The program spans several months, covering criminal law, report writing, traffic enforcement, ethics, and constitutional law aligned with state training standards.

Can I balance work or family commitments while attending the academy?

The schedule is intensive and typically requires full-time commitment, so prior personal and work arrangements are important to plan carefully.

What career opportunities open up after graduating from Angelina College Police Academy?

Graduates are eligible to seek entry-level positions with local and regional law enforcement agencies, often receiving consideration for patrol and community policing roles.
